Transaction 176cc09d1defc995bf39d64df62b084ca1bb8a162b16003292c9de3032e8babc

88 Input
2 Outputs
  • 176cc09d1defc995bf39d64df62b084ca1bb8a162b16003292c9de3032e8babc:0
  • value  1000000000
    address  3ACRqySbpsVkQLmVraLC4NvUgRLXQ3UZR4
  • 176cc09d1defc995bf39d64df62b084ca1bb8a162b16003292c9de3032e8babc:1
  • value  1675533
    address  34BTyXK2phMBWrFfUuhHiyURJzmutCNwFN